WebTIL the Flying Hamburger was Germany's first fast diesel train right before Hitler took power. It attained a speed of around 160 km/h. It was the fastest regular rail connection in its time. WebThe streamlined "A4 Class" of express locomotives (which entered into service in 1935) was designed by Sir Nigel Gresley after his experience of travelling on the streamlined Flying Hamburger train in Germany impressed on him the possibilities and advantages offered by streamlining.A4 locomotive number 4498 was the one hundredth Gresley steam …
